Per Orlando Sentinel.
TALLAHASSEE — Amid rumors that Florida football players vandalized the visiting locker room at Florida State following the Gators' 31-7 loss here on Saturday, a Florida State athletic department official said the visiting locker room was left in no worse condition than it normally is following a game.
The official, who spoke on condition of anonymity, said on Tuesday that rumors of damage to the Seminoles' visiting locker room had been "completely overblown."
The Rivals.com-affiliated website that covers Florida State reported on Monday night that the Gators had "trashed" their locker room after their 24-point loss. The Florida State athletic department official said the report wasn't accurate.
Florida officials also said there was no problem with the locker room.
